Candidates for Nominet Elections Announced

October 11, 2021 by Michele Neylon

This year’s Nominet Board elections will be for two non-executive directors (NEDs). As usual the seats are open to anyone and they don’t need to be a Nominet member to be elected, though only Nominet members get to vote.

The full slate of nominees was announced earlier this afternoon. With 6 candidates running for 2 seats this will be one of the more hotly contested elections in a long time. The candidate breakdown and profile is quite different from previous years but how things will pan out is anyone’s guess at this juncture.

Here’s the candidate list:

  • Ashley La Bolle
  • David Thornton
  • Jim Davies
  • Liz Williams
  • Simon Blacker
  • Stephen Yarrow

Some of those names are probably familiar to anyone who has been actively engaged in Nominet or country code domains over the last few years, while others probably aren’t that well known. I’d recommend reading the candidate statements as well as those from the people who nominated them. They’re quite enlightening and can definitely help you to get to know the candidates and how they are perceived.

The voting will open on October 27th.

Traditionally the voter turnout has been pretty low, though I suspect it could be higher this year.

Voting rights are based on the number of domains each member has linked to their membership with caps in place for the larger companies.
